Ingredients & Equipment for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ta
Right, let's dive into what you'll need for this absolutely banging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ta. Honestly, it's so easy chicken pasta , it's almost embarrassing.
And it will be on the table in about 30 minute meals !
Main Players in Our Italian Chicken Pasta
- Pasta: 1 pound (455g) of your favorite. Fettuccine is the classic, but spaghetti or even penne work great. I’ve even used those fancy spirals when I'm feeling a bit posh!
- Water: 8 cups (1.9 liters) for boiling the pasta.
- Olive Oil: 1 tablespoon (15 ml) . Just regular stuff is fine.
- Salt: 1 teaspoon (6g) . We’re not scrimping on flavor here.
- Chicken: 1 pound (455g) of boneless, skinless chicken breasts. Cut them into bite sized pieces. If they are organic or high welfare, go for it. But if it is regular chicken breast, it will do the job very nicely.
- Olive Oil: 1 tablespoon (15 ml) for cooking the chicken.
- Salt: ½ teaspoon (3g) to season the chicken.
- Black Pepper: ¼ teaspoon (1g) because everything tastes better with a bit of pepper.
- Italian Herbs: 1 teaspoon (3g) dried herbs. A mix of oregano, basil, rosemary, and thyme will nail it.
- Butter: 4 tablespoons (56g) unsalted. Don't go for the spreadable stuff; proper butter is key for the creamy garlic sauce for pasta .
- Garlic: 4 cloves , minced. About 1 tablespoon. And no, garlic powder is NOT a substitute. Use fresh garlic, trust me.
- Heavy Cream: 1 cup (240ml) . Full fat is the way to go for this creamy pasta recipe .
- Chicken Broth: ½ cup (120ml) . You can use stock cubes if you're in a pinch.
- Parmesan Cheese: ½ cup (50g) , grated. Plus extra for serving, because why not? Get a good quality Parmesan it makes a world of difference. Avoid the pre-grated stuff if you can; it often has a weird texture.
- Salt: ¼ teaspoon (1g) , or to taste, for the sauce.
- Black Pepper: ⅛ teaspoon (0.5g) , or to taste, for the sauce.
- Parsley: 2 tablespoons (12g) , chopped. This is optional, but it adds a nice pop of freshness.

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ta: step-by-step
This easy chicken pasta comes together so fast, it’s almost criminal!
- Boil your pasta in salted water. Add a dash of olive oil to prevent sticking. Aim for al dente . Nobody likes mushy pasta. Drain and set aside.
- Cook your garlic parmesan chicken in olive oil over medium high heat. Season with salt, pepper, and Italian herbs. Cook until the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165° F ( 74° C) . Remove and set aside.
- Melt butter in the same pan. Add minced garlic and cook until fragrant. Only about 30 seconds ! You don't want it to burn.
- Pour in heavy cream and chicken broth. Simmer until slightly thickened, around 3- 5 minutes .
- Stir in grated Parmesan cheese until melted and smooth. Season with salt and pepper to taste. It’s all about that delicious creamy garlic sauce for pasta !
- Add the cooked chicken and pasta to the sauce. Toss to coat evenly.
Pro Tips for Pasta Perfection
Want to level up your chicken parmesan pasta recipe ? Use freshly grated Parmesan. The flavor is so much better. Also, taste and season the sauce. It makes all the difference!
Common mistake alert: Overcooking the chicken. No one wants dry chicken! Cook it just until it reaches temperature. Don't be afraid to use a thermometer! And if you are thinking in advance, the sauce can be made a day before.

Storage Tips: Keep it Fresh, Keep it Safe!
So, you’ve made a massive batch of this easy chicken pasta . No judgement here! To store it properly, let the pasta cool completely before popping it in an airtight container.
It'll happily sit in the fridge for up to 3 days. Don't leave it out at room temperature for more than 2 hours, okay?
Freezing is an option, but the sauce might change texture slightly. If you do freeze it, use it within 2 months.
For reheating, a gentle simmer on the hob with a splash of milk or chicken broth works best. Microwaving is fine, but keep an eye on it to prevent it drying out.

Frequently Asked Questions
How can I prevent my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ta sauce from being too watery?
Nobody wants a watery sauce! To avoid this, ensure you simmer the heavy cream and chicken broth mixture long enough for it to thicken slightly before adding the Parmesan. Also, freshly grated Parmesan melts better and helps to thicken the sauce.
If it's still too thin, a tiny pinch of cornstarch mixed with cold water can work wonders, just like they do on MasterChef!
Can I make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ta ahead of time?
While this dish is best served fresh, you can prep elements ahead. Cook the chicken and pasta separately, and prepare the sauce but don't combine it all until just before serving. When reheating, you might need to add a splash of milk or chicken broth to loosen the sauce, as pasta tends to absorb it.
Think of it like giving your dish a little 'zhuzh' before serving!
What are some good variations I can try with this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ta recipe?
Oh, the possibilities! For a veggie boost, toss in some sautéed spinach, mushrooms, or sun-dried tomatoes. If you're feeling adventurous, add a pinch of red pepper flakes for a spicy kick like adding a little fire to your Bake Off! You could even swap the chicken for shrimp or sausage, because why not?
How long does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ta last in the fridge, and how do I reheat it?
Properly stored in an airtight container, your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ta will last for up to 3-4 days in the fridge. When reheating, add a splash of milk or chicken broth to prevent it from drying out. You can microwave it (in short bursts, stirring in between) or reheat it in a skillet over low heat.
Just ensure it's heated through properly, no one wants a dodgy tummy!
Is there a lighter or healthier version of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ta I can make?
Absolutely! You can lighten things up by using half and-half or evaporated milk instead of heavy cream in the sauce. Also, consider using whole wheat pasta for added fiber. Another trick is to use a smaller amount of Parmesan cheese and load up on vegetables like broccoli or asparagus.
A little tweak here and there can make a big difference, just like switching from full fat to semi skimmed milk!
What's the best type of pasta to use for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ta?
While fettuccine is a classic choice and works beautifully with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ta, feel free to get creative. Other long pasta shapes like spaghetti or linguine work great, as do penne or rotini.
Ultimately, it's down to personal preference, but a shape with ridges will hold that luscious sauce even better!
